What precautions should be taken when handling 3-Methoxy-5-methylpyrazin-2-amine (CAS: 89464-87-9)?

When handling 3-Methoxy-5-methylpyrazin-2-amine (CAS: 89464-87-9), it is important to wear appropriate personal protective equipment (PPE), including gloves, goggles, and a lab coat. Work should be conducted in a well-ventilated area or a fume hood to avoid inhalation. Spills should be cleaned up using appropriate absorbent materials and ensuring proper disposal. Always consult the Safety Data Sheet (SDS) for detailed safety information and emergency procedures.
